About Super Lawyers

Super Lawyers states that its process involves the selection of attorneys using a "patented multiphase selection process combining peer nominations and evaluations with independent research," and that "each candidate is evaluated on 12 indicators of peer recognition and professional achievement." They state that selections are made on an annual, state-by-state basis. According to Super Lawyers, their objective is to create a credible, comprehensive, and diverse listing of outstanding attorneys that can be used as a resource for attorneys and consumers searching for legal counsel. Regarding its Rising Stars category, Super Lawyers states that eligibility for inclusion requires that a candidate must be either 40 years old or younger or in practice for 10 years or less.

About Peckar & Abramson, P.C.

P&A is a national law firm with offices in New York City, New Jersey, Washington D.C., Boston, Miami, Chicago, Los Angeles, Austin, Houston, and Dallas, and has affiliations with global firms in Latin America (through its founding membership in CONSTRULEGAL) and across Europe (through its founding membership in Leading Construction Lawyers International Alliance). In addition to its core construction practice, the firm has affiliated practice groups who counsel contractors on labor and employment matters, regulatory compliance issues including D/M/WBE compliance, and general corporate and real estate matters.
